Three common treatment myths of bone and joint disease 1, long-term reliance on allopathic treatment Bone and joint disease is often accompanied by severe pain and swelling, in order to reduce the pain, some times do need allopathic treatment (i.e., treat the symptoms, meaning to eliminate or improve the symptoms of the disease). However, allopathic treatment does not address the root cause of the problem and therefore cannot be relied upon in the long term. At present, symptomatic treatment mainly includes taking analgesic and anti-inflammatory drugs and physical therapy (massage, traction, physiotherapy, etc.). (1) Long-term use of analgesic and anti-inflammatory drugs Analgesic and anti-inflammatory drugs include hormones (such as prednisone, dexamethasone, etc.) and non-hormones (such as aspirin, ibuprofen, anti-inflammatory pain, diclofenac, fotarol, etc.), which are characterized by rapid and obvious pain relief and swelling reduction, but these drugs can only relieve the symptoms, and cannot control the development of lesions, and they cannot play a therapeutic role. (2) Physical therapy such as traction, massage, acupuncture, etc. Physical therapy can only temporarily relieve the symptoms, and cannot achieve the purpose of fundamental treatment. Third, prevention and treatment of osteoarthrosis, must be both the symptoms and the root cause 1, the disease in the joint root in the cartilage Scientific research has proved that: cartilage damage is the “culprit” of osteoarthrosis. As we age, the synthesis of proteoglycans in joint cartilage decreases, the cartilage surface becomes convex and uneven, and the bone under the cartilage is gradually exposed. As a result, the bones lose the necessary protection, which can easily cause bone damage. Further development will lead to bone sclerosis, thickening, synovial tissue damage, which will lead to joint deformity, necrosis, loss of function. 2, cartilage “not afraid of grinding”, only afraid of nutritional imbalance The basic function of cartilage is to maintain joint elasticity, maintain joint performance, so normal sports and physical activity will not lead to joint damage. The real reason for cartilage damage is due to an imbalance in nutritional metabolism, which causes erosion within the cartilage. Collagen fibers, the main matrix of cartilage, are intertwined and arranged in a network, while proteoglycans are clustered in the collagen fiber spaces. As we age, the synthesis of proteoglycans decreases, while the breakdown continues. Over time, gaps appear between the collagen fibers and the fibers collapse due to lack of support, resulting in uneven cartilage and the invasion of free radicals and inflammatory substances, thus activating matrix enzymes and proteases that destroy cartilage.
